It all really depends on the college you apply to; if you want to get a lot of scholarships it would probably be a smarter idea to apply to a less diverse school, or one with a low population of students from India, as they'll likely be trying to up their student diversity at the time, and you might be able to find some sort of scholarship open just for being a minority (by US standards). You could also find out if there are any sponsored scholarships available; usually these involve you entering an essay on an assigned topic. It's more work, but can make a big difference. These likely won't be listed on school websites though, so you'll have to go out of your way a bit more to find them. One thing that schools will put a lot of stress on is your overall grades through primary school, class ranking, financial status, family history, extracurricular activities, and course load. If possible, I would retake the SATs if I were you. And apply for a lot of scholarships; there will be more available for private colleges versus public ones, but the private are also altogether more expensive. It would be in your best interest to get as many scholarships as possible in a few schools that you'd like to go to, and see which one is cheaper with all of them factored in. Sometimes a private college can end up costing less because of scholarships than a public one. I hope any of that was of use... Good luck!!
